Default How to remove dash cover?

Hey guys, I have a very annoying rattle somewhere under my dashboard on the passenger side. I have removed my glove box, but it's coming from somewhere higher. So I tried to remove the dash cover, but found no ways to do it. I removed the speaker cover and the A/C vent, but it doesn't look like there are anything else I can do. Almost like it's glued down. Is it? If not, how do you remove the top of the dash?
